Переключатели в Excel полезны для создания интерактивных форм и сбора данных, введенных пользователем. Однако могут возникнуть ситуации, когда вам потребуется удалить переключатели из электронной таблицы. В этой статье мы рассмотрим несколько способов удаления переключателей в Excel, а также приведем примеры кода для каждого подхода.
Метод 1. Удаление переключателей вручную
- Откройте таблицу Excel.
- Выберите лист, содержащий переключатели.
- Нажмите на вкладку «Разработчик» на ленте (если она не отображается, включите ее в параметрах Excel).
- В группе «Элементы управления» нажмите кнопку «Режим дизайна», чтобы активировать режим дизайна.
- Найдите переключатель, который хотите удалить.
- Нажмите правой кнопкой мыши на переключатель и выберите «Вырезать» или нажмите клавишу «Удалить» на клавиатуре.
- Повторите шаги 5 и 6 для каждого переключателя, который хотите удалить.
- После удаления всех нужных переключателей снова нажмите кнопку «Режим дизайна», чтобы деактивировать режим дизайна.
Метод 2: использование VBA (Visual Basic для приложений)
Если у вас большое количество переключателей или вы хотите автоматизировать процесс удаления, вы можете использовать VBA для программного удаления переключателей. Выполните следующие действия:
- Нажмите «Alt + F11», чтобы открыть редактор Visual Basic.
- В окне Project Explorer найдите модуль листа, в котором расположены переключатели.
- Дважды щелкните модуль листа, чтобы открыть окно кода.
- Скопируйте и вставьте следующий код VBA в окно кода:
Sub RemoveRadioButtons()
Dim shp As Shape
For Each shp In ActiveSheet.Shapes
If shp.Type = msoFormControl Then
If shp.FormControlType = xlOptionButton Then
shp.Delete
End If
End If
Next shp
End Sub
- Закройте редактор Visual Basic.
- Нажмите «Alt + F8», чтобы открыть диалоговое окно «Макрос».
- Выберите макрос «RemoveRadioButtons» и нажмите кнопку «Выполнить».
Этот код VBA просматривает все фигуры на активном листе и удаляет все встреченные переключатели.
Метод 3: использование панели выбора
В Excel предусмотрена функция «Панель выбора», которая позволяет управлять объектами на листе и выбирать их, включая переключатели. Вот как вы можете использовать его для удаления переключателей:
- Выберите лист, содержащий переключатели.
- Перейдите на вкладку «Главная» и нажмите кнопку «Найти и выбрать» в группе «Редактирование».
- В раскрывающемся меню выберите «Панель выбора».
- Панель выбора появится в правой части окна Excel, отображая все объекты на листе.
- Найдите переключатель, который хотите удалить, на панели выбора.
- Нажмите правой кнопкой мыши имя переключателя на панели выбора и выберите «Удалить».
- Повторите шаги 5 и 6 для каждого переключателя, который хотите удалить.
- Закройте панель выбора, когда закончите.
В этой статье мы рассмотрели три способа удаления переключателей в Excel. Первый метод предполагает ручное удаление переключателей по одному. Второй метод использует VBA для программного удаления переключателей, что полезно для автоматизации процесса. Наконец, третий метод использует функцию панели выбора Excel для удаления переключателей. Выберите метод, который соответствует вашим требованиям, и упростите таблицы Excel, удалив ненужные переключатели.